QML(Qt建模语言)是一种声明性语言,允许用户界面根据其可视组件以及它们如何相互作用和相互关联来描述。它是一种高度可读的语言,类似JSON的语法,支持命令式JavaScript表达式和动态属性绑定。它可用于构建流体动画用户界面,可以连接到任何后端C ++库。
我有以下函数,它返回一个 javascript 数组作为 QJSValue。但是当我从 QML 调用此函数时,生成的对象始终是“未定义”。 MyClass 类:公共 QOb...
我目前正在阅读 QML 文档,我意识到没有关于如何定义应用程序图标的解释。 我尝试了一些方法,但这不起作用: int main(int argc, char *argv[]) {
我的应用程序正在嵌入另一个应用程序中运行,该应用程序使用窗口句柄类名来获取它。我正在使用 Qt 5.7.1 和 QML 运行我的应用程序。 QML 位于 QQuickViewer 中,...
我在qml中使用swipeview。我可以将项目从第一个滑动到最后一个,然后再返回。是否可以立即从最后滑动到第一?我在文档中没有找到任何信息。
我想知道是否有任何方法可以让 ListView 表现得像桌面控件一样,而不会对滚动到鼠标拖动做出反应? 我知道交互式属性,但我仍然想要 ListVi...
我正在尝试了解锚点并在自定义元素中使用。这是一个简单的矩形。但我的问题是两个自定义矩形元素相互重叠。 //CRect.qml 导入 QtQuick 2.12...
当我关注其他内容但又回到原始项目时,Keys.onPressed 停止工作
我面临着一些我无法解释的事情...... 我有这个代码: 导入QtQuick 2.12 导入 QtQuick.Controls 2.0 导入 QtQuick.Controls.Styles 1.4 导入 QtGraphicalEffects 1.12 导入 QtQuick.LocalS...
我有一个包含具有多个页面的 StackView 的主页:主菜单,param1Page,param2Page,.... 如果激活的项目不是“主菜单&...”,我想在主页上显示主页按钮
如何使 C++ 中的 Q_ENUM 用作 QML 中组合框的选项
我正在使用Qt6.5.1,并且我已经在QML中创建了ComboBox。以下是我所做的。 我有以下 C++ 课程。 类 MyComboBoxOptions :公共 QObject { Q_OBJECT Q_PROPERTY(QStringList
如何在 QML 中创建一个没有标题栏但带有关闭/最小化/最大化按钮的窗口?
我想创建一个没有标题栏的应用程序,但具有本机关闭、最小化和最大化按钮。这是布局的意图: 该应用程序是使用 Go 和 QML 构建的。我能够删除...
是否可以知道QML控件的默认大小(高度)?类似于 QWidget::sizeHint()... 我想将 TextField 的隐式高度设置为 8mm,这在桌面上没问题,但在 Andr 上...
我正在尝试更熟悉使用 CMake 编译 QML 项目并将其烘焙到 Yocto 图像中的工具链。但是,我在配置方面遇到了问题。 我正在使用 QML 考试...
对于一个项目,我在表格中显示数据,最新的数据是最相关的,所以我希望它是最明显的,但也应该可以看到较早的数据。 以下代码
对于一个项目,我在表格中显示数据,最新的数据是最相关的,所以我希望它是最明显的,但也应该可以看到较早的数据。 以下代码...
在下面的代码中,可以从listmodel中删除一个点,并在下一行中显示ReferenceError:pthModel未定义。请问你能帮帮我吗? 导入QtQuick 导入 QtQuick.Shapes 2.15
我创建了一个简单的可重复示例来实现我想要实现的目标。 ListView 动态填充字符串,只要有新内容就可以向下滚动内容。 但它并不...
在 Qt5 中,使用 DropShadow 很容易做到这一点。 但在 Qt6 中,模块 QtGraphicalEffects 被删除。 Qt6 中是否有任何技巧、解决方法或新方法可以在某些组件周围创建阴影?
我遇到扫描二维数据矩阵条形码的问题,我发现扫描时缺少不同的字符。此问题仅发生在 Linux 上。 GD4500 Datamatrix 扫描仪可用作键盘楔...
我在另一个具有 MouseArea 的项目中拥有 TableView。如何将所有鼠标事件传递给 TableView 的父级(或者换句话说,使其对鼠标事件透明)?
我正在尝试使用 PySide6 和集成的 VtkRenderWindow 获取 Qml 应用程序的运行示例。 我尝试了 Qml-VTK-Python 但生成的有问题 来自 pyside6 的 rs_qml.py...